February Tasks

Prepare vegetable seed beds, and sow some vegetables under cover
Start chitting potatoes
Prune winter-flowering shrubs that have finished flowering
Prune Wisteria
Prune hardy evergreen hedges and renovate overgrown deciduous hedges
Prune conservatory climbers
Cut grass on a high cut when the day is dry and slightly windy.
Check and repair pergolas and arches if needed.
Rub down and treat wooden garden furniture when dry.
Remove algae from paths if they start to become slippery.
divide and replant early spring bulbs that have finished flowering
Check fruit and veg stores for rot or rodent damage. Don’t forget the stored cannas and dahlias.
Trim the old leaves from hellebores and epimedium to reveal the new flowers
Sow sweet peas on a cool windowsill or coldframe
Regularly check greenhouse heaters and fleece.
